Through the course of multiple interviews, exchanges, and many hours of footage, we have produced a short documentary which MCLARAN - SALEM AREA CHAMBER OF COMMERCE The Salem Area Chamber of Commerce began its annual golf tournament in 1989. The tournament was renamed in 2013 in honor of Mike McLaran, who passed away suddenly in March of 2013. Mike served as CEO of the Salem Chamber for 16 years, and was a leader, a colleague, a mentor and a friend to many in our community. CATALYST INVESTOR - SAIF SAIF is Oregon’s not-for-profit workers’ compensation insurance company. Since 1914, we’ve been taking care of injured workers, helping people get back to work, and keeping rates low by focusing on workplace safety. Together with our partners, we strive to make Oregon the safest and healthiest place to work.Learn More

CATALYST INVESTOR - SAALFELD GRIGGS PC Saalfeld Griggs is a respected Oregon business law firm with clients throughout the Willamette Valley and Pacific Northwest. Founded in Salem, Oregon in 1932, Saalfeld Griggs is large enough to handle complex business litigation and business transactions, yet small enough to develop close working relationships with its business clients. With clients doing business from Portland to Medford, Eugene to Bend, and Seattle to Ashland, the goal of each of our business lawyers is to learn about the client’s business, understand their needs and goals, and efficiently develop practical and cost-effectivelegal strategies.

CATALYST INVESTOR - ILLAHE HILLS COUNTRY CLUB Welcome to Illahe Hills Country Club, providing a challenging golf experience in a grand setting. A backdrop of trees line the traditional layout, designed by renowned golf course architect William Bell and opened for play in 1961. Illahe Hills has played host to many of Oregon’s major golf events, as well as USGA Championships.Learn More
